The Advantages of Cylindrical Roller Bearings in Modern Applications Cylindrical roller bearings (CRBs) are a class of rolling-element bearings that have gained popularity in various mechanical applications due to their unique design and operational benefits. These bearings consist of cylindrical rolling elements that facilitate smooth rotation and offer significant load-bearing capabilities. Among the various types of bearings available, cylindrical roller bearings stand out for several compelling reasons. The Advantages of Cylindrical Roller Bearings in Modern Applications In addition to their superior load-bearing capacity, cylindrical roller bearings are known for their excellent performance at high speeds. The roller design minimizes friction between the rolling elements and the raceways, resulting in reduced heat generation. This quality is essential in high-speed applications where excessive heat can lead to premature bearing failure. They are available in various designs and configurations, including single-row, double-row, and multi-row arrangements. This flexibility allows engineers to select the most appropriate bearing type based on specific application requirements. For instance, double-row cylindrical roller bearings are often utilized in scenarios where axial space is limited, while single-row variants are suitable for applications with ample space and high load requirements. Another noteworthy benefit of cylindrical roller bearings is their ease of maintenance. With lower friction levels and reduced wear, these bearings often result in an extended service life compared to other types of bearings. Regular lubrication and proper alignment can further enhance their durability, making them a cost-effective choice in the long run. The reduced downtime associated with maintenance and replacement also contributes positively to overall productivity in industrial settings. Furthermore, the adaptability of cylindrical roller bearings extends to their compatibility with various seals and shields. This allows for protection against contamination, which is essential in environments exposed to dust and debris. By preventing contaminants from entering the bearing, the longevity and efficiency of the bearing can be significantly improved.
